Applications
Multi-cryogenics is designed specifically for use with fully
refrigerated conveyants down to -50°C on ships, barges and in marine
terminals. This application is including the following medie:
Ammonia, Acetaldehyde, Butadiene, Butane, Propane, Butylene,
Dimethylamide, Ethylamine, Ethyl Chloride, Methyl Acethylene, Methyl
Bromide Propane, Propadiene, Propylene, Vinyl Chloride, Refrigerant
Gases. Multi-cryogenics is also suitable for:
Liquid Ethylene at -105°C, Liquid Ethane at -88°C.
Construction
| Inner wire | Stainless steel 316 |
| Lining / carcass | Polyamide films, fabrics and BOPP |
| Outer wire | Galvanized- or Stainless steel 316 |
| Temperature range |
-50 °C to 50 °C |
| Safety factor |
Working pressures based on safety factor 5:1. |
